Boosting efficiency in SCADA systems

by Jessica Dickers
March 16, 2016
in Digital Utilities, News, Telecommunications
Reading Time: 2 mins read
A A
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

SCADA 2016 will discuss technologies and solutions to boost the efficiency of SCADA systems and the strategies that can reduce cost and help to establish proactive management of systems.

SCADA 2016 will be held from the 24 – 26 May in Melbourne and will feature presentations from:

  • Mike Wassell, Hydraulic Systems Services Manager at Sydney Water
  • Andrew West, SCADA Expert at DNP Technical Committee
  • Jim Baker, Principal SCADA Engineer at Water Corporation of WA
  • Sean Murdoch, Control Systems Management and Support Manager at QLD Urban Utilities

SCADA Manager at Coliban Water, Dan Smith’s experience implementing these strategies is highlighted in his team’s three-stage optimisation program, which saved on cost and improved system performance.

Mr Smith’s optimisation program covered:

  • Upgrading from an analogue to digital UHS system to conduct firmware upgrades and manage devices remotely.
  • Shifting from a proprietary to an open-protocol network to support DNP3 and enable predictive analytics for maintenance.
  • Rolling out new RTU platforms that accommodate DNP3 and overcome hardware obsolescence issues.
